Who Was Hisashi Ouchi?

Hisashi Ouchi was a Japanese nuclear plant worker who became known for being one of the victims of the Tokaimura nuclear accident in 1999. This tragic event not only altered his life forever but also raised important questions about nuclear safety protocols. What Happened During the Tokaimura Nuclear Accident?

The Tokaimura nuclear accident was a tragic event that unfolded due to a criticality accident while workers were processing uranium at a fuel conversion facility. In this section, we explore the details of the incident that led to Hisashi Ouchi’s severe radiation exposure and the subsequent impact on his health.

  • On September 30, 1999, workers at the JCO facility in Tokaimura mistakenly mixed too much uranium in a container.
  • The mix created a nuclear chain reaction, resulting in a massive release of radiation.
  • Hisashi Ouchi was one of the workers exposed to lethal doses of radiation.
  • The accident prompted immediate evacuations and emergency medical responses.

How Did Hisashi Ouchi's Accident Affect His Health?

Following the accident, Hisashi Ouchi’s health deteriorated rapidly. The severe radiation exposure led to acute radiation syndrome, which is life-threatening and can result in numerous health complications. Here’s a brief overview of his medical journey post-accident:

  • Ouchi suffered from severe burns and internal damage due to radiation.
  • He was hospitalized and placed under intensive care for several months.
  • Despite medical efforts, his condition worsened, leading to his eventual death on December 21, 1999.

What Legacy Did Hisashi Ouchi Leave Behind?

Hisashi Ouchi's story is not just one of tragedy; it is also a call to action. The aftermath of the Tokaimura accident led to significant changes in Japan's nuclear safety regulations. Hisashi Ouchi's legacy is a reminder of the importance of safety protocols and the ethical responsibilities that come with handling nuclear materials.
